Upload Your Site to Google: A Step-by-Step Guide
Ready to get your website noticed by the world? Submitting your site to Google is a crucial step in ensuring its visibility. By registering your site with Google, you allow search engines to crawl its content, ultimately leading to more traffic and potential users.
- First, create a Google Search Console account. This free tool gives you insights into your site's performance in Google search results.
- Next, authenticate ownership of your website within Google Search Console. You can achieve by adding a meta tag to your site's HTML, uploading an HTML file to your server's root directory, or by applying a Google Analytics account.
- Then, upload a sitemap to Google Search Console. A sitemap is an structured list of all the pages on your website, making it easier for search engines to navigate its contents.
- Finally, observe your site's performance in Google Search Console. Regularly examine your search results to recognize areas for improvement and optimize your site's visibility.
